Grumbling to his friend Edmund Wilson shortly after publication in 1925, Fitzgerald declared that "of all the ... chertsey auction houseWebApr 18, 2024 · The Great Gatsby takes place in New York City, East Egg, West Egg, and the Valley of Ashes. The so-called “nouveau riches” (or “new money”) live in West Egg, while the old aristocratic families prefer East Egg. Between the Eggs and NYC lies the Valley of Ashes, the symbol of decay.
